应用程序的名称是否可用作变量?

时间:2013-10-12 12:22:10

标签: ruby-on-rails ruby

当我创建rails应用程序时,

控制台:

rails new foo

我的代码可以使用字符串“foo”吗?

puts "Your app's name is " + app_name_bar

1 个答案:

答案 0 :(得分:9)

Rails.application.class将为您提供应用程序的全名(例如YourAppName :: Application)。

从那里,您可以使用Rails.application.class.parent获取模块名称。

相关问题